My copy of CMON's Rising Sun game finally arrived. Approximately 15 lbs. of gaming goodness. 116 32mm scale miniatures; humans, monsters, and gods. The box and component artwork is outstanding. A quick review of the rules gave me the impression of an easy to learn game with lots of subtlety. A game is played in four seasonal turns with most of the action in the Spring, Summer and Autumn turns. Each season has multiple political phases where you raise and train armies, summon priests and monsters and garner resources. Each season ends in a single war phase where possession of provinces is determined. The winner of the game is determined by the number of provinces owned during the Winter turn. I pretty much went all in getting the base game, large expansion and three smaller expansions. Now my only decision is whether to paint the minis. The detail is a bit daunting to a duffer like me.
